Welcome to 'Everywhere We Go' - a cricket podcast produced by England's Barmy Army. If you want chat about seam positions and long barriers, this isn't the podcast for you. If you like reminiscing about legendary stories from past England tours, learning about the creation of famous Barmy Army anthems and hearing exclusive stories from some of the biggest names in the game, you'll want to stick around!

The second most important man in Pakistan - Wasim Khan 14.12.2020

Chief Executive of the Pakistan Cricket Board, Wasim Khan graces the podcast with his presence, to talk about the slow return of touring parties to the country, his own First Class career (where he won a County Championship and a NatWest Trophy) and how he even got there in the first place. THE GOAT - Jimmy Anderson 27.05.2020

151 Test matches, 584 wickets... and still rising.... the genuine Greatest Of All Time and the King of Swing joins the podcast. With so much to cover, Jimmy talks about his early fielding prowess at Burnley CC, his hatred for Yorkshiremen, breaking into the England side and breaking a rib on THAT training camp in Germany before the 2010/11 Ashes series.  Remember to get in touch with where you're...
